Where to Find Your Hyundai Sonata LF Service Manual
Now, let's talk about where to get your hands on this magical manual. Luckily, there are a few options available, each with its own pros and cons.
Official Hyundai Service Manuals
The best place to start is with the official source. Hyundai often provides service manuals for their vehicles, either in print or digital format. These manuals are typically the most comprehensive and accurate, as they are created by the manufacturer themselves. You can often find them at your local Hyundai dealership or on the official Hyundai website. Keep in mind that these manuals might come at a cost, but the investment is often worth it for the quality of information provided. These official manuals are the gold standard. If you're serious about maintaining your Sonata LF, going with an official manual is usually the best choice, especially for complex procedures or when you want factory-level guidance.
Third-Party Service Manuals
If you're looking for a more affordable option, third-party service manuals are a great alternative. Companies like Haynes and Chilton produce manuals for a wide range of vehicles, including the Hyundai Sonata LF. These manuals offer detailed instructions and diagrams, often at a lower price point than the official manuals. They're usually targeted at DIYers, so the language and procedures are often easier to understand. However, keep in mind that these manuals might not be as detailed or specific as the official ones, particularly for complex systems or new technologies. Always check reviews to make sure the manual is well-regarded and covers the specific features and systems of your Sonata LF. These are a good budget-friendly choice.
Online Resources and Forums
In addition to the physical and digital manuals, there are tons of online resources. You can find a wealth of information on car forums, owner clubs, and websites dedicated to Hyundai vehicles. Often, owners share repair tips, troubleshooting advice, and even specific sections of service manuals. This can be a great way to get help with specific problems or learn about common issues. However, be cautious about the accuracy of the information you find online. Always cross-reference information from multiple sources and use your best judgment. While online resources are invaluable, they shouldn't be your only source of information, especially when dealing with complex repairs or safety-related issues.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with the Hyundai Sonata LF
Even with a service manual, you might encounter some common issues with your Hyundai Sonata LF. Knowing these problems and how to troubleshoot them can be super helpful. Here are a few common issues and how to troubleshoot them:
Engine Problems
Engine problems can range from minor issues to major failures. If you experience engine problems, here's what you can do. Common issues include: rough idling, loss of power, and check engine lights. Check the service manual for troubleshooting guides. Start by checking the basics like spark plugs, air filters, and fuel injectors. Use an OBD-II scanner to read any error codes. Follow the manual's troubleshooting steps for each error code.
Electrical Problems
Electrical problems can be tricky, but the service manual is a great resource. If you have any electrical issues, try these things. Common issues include: dead batteries, blown fuses, and malfunctioning lights. Check the battery voltage and connections. Inspect the fuses and replace any blown ones. Use the wiring diagrams in the manual to trace the problem.
Transmission Problems
Transmission problems can be costly, so early detection is key. If you encounter any transmission issues. Common issues include: slipping gears, hard shifting, and transmission fluid leaks. Check the transmission fluid level and condition. Inspect for leaks. Consult the manual's troubleshooting guides for the specific symptoms you're experiencing.
Suspension Problems
Suspension problems can affect ride quality and handling. If you think there are suspension problems. Common issues include: clunking noises, uneven tire wear, and a bouncy ride. Inspect the shocks, struts, and springs for damage or wear. Check the tire pressure and alignment. Consult the manual's troubleshooting guides for your specific symptoms.
